using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ace APT.BaseData.Domain.Enums
{
///
/// 平台类型
///
public enum PFPlatTypeEnum
{
/// 后台
后台 = 0,
/// 客户端
客户端 = 1,
/// APP
APP = 2,
}
///
/// 表单类型
///
public enum PFFormTypeEnum
{
/// 列表表单
列表表单 = 0,
/// 编辑表单
编辑表单 = 1,
/// 树形编辑页
树形编辑页 = 2,
/// 图表表单
图表表单 = 3,
/// 图片表单
图片表单 = 4,
/// 外部链接
外部链接 = 5,
/// 横向树编辑页
横向树编辑页 = 6,
/// 组合表单
组合表单 = 7,
/// 组合表单
可编辑列表表单 = 8,
/// 自定义表单
自定义表单 = 99,
}
/// 模块划分
public enum PFModuleTypeEnum
{
[Description("HM")]
首页模板 = -1,
[Description("PF")]
平台管理 = 0,
[Description("BD")]
基础数据 = 1,
[Description("EM")]
能源监测 = 2,
[Description("ED")]
能源调度 = 3,
[Description("FM")]
工厂建模 = 4,
[Description("PM")]
计划管理 = 5,
[Description("EA")]
能源核算 = 6,
[Description("QC")]
能源质量 = 7,
[Description("MR")]
资源管理 = 8,
[Description("FC")]
财务计费 = 9,
[Description("DD")]
数据对接 = 10,
[Description("LG")]
日志管理 = 12,
[Description("NW")]
通知预警 = 13,
[Description("KR")]
看板报表 = 14,
[Description("CP")]
充电桩 = 15,
[Description("CM")]
充电监控 = 16,
[Description("SO")]
订单管理 = 17,
[Description("CA")]
报警管理 = 18,
[Description("MT")]
维修保养 = 19,
[Description("MB")]
移动管理 = 20,
[Description("MT")]
会议管理 = 21,
//[Description("TI")]
//安全投入 = 22,
//[Description("AE")]
//事故事件 = 22,
//[Description("OH")]
//职业卫生 = 25,
[Description("CM")]
应急管理 = 25,
[Description("DM")]
机电管理 = 27,
[Description("BI")]
BI展示 = 28,
//[Description("TL")]
//尾矿库 = 29,
}
///
/// 用户类型
///
public enum PFUserTypeEnum
{
普通用户 = 0,
管理员 = 99,
}
public enum PFFormConfigVersionEnum
{
Form = 0,
Btn = 1,
Column = 2,
EditColumn = 3,
EditColumnFillMap = 4,
EditColumnFillMapDetail = 5,
EditColumnFilter = 6,
PageCustom = 7,
PageEdit = 8,
PageTable = 9,
PageTree = 10,
Query = 11,
TableParams = 12,
TreeColumn = 13,
PageEditPanel = 14,
PageChart = 15,
PageChartParam = 16,
ColumnFilter = 17,
FormQuery = 18,
PageTablePanel = 19,
ParamItem = 20,
ParamScheme = 21,
}
}